Pakistan - Number of Estimated Multi-Drug Resistant Tuberculosis (MDR-TB) Cases Among Notified Pulmonary Tuberculosis Cases
In 2014, the country was number 5 among other countries in Number of Estimated Multi-Drug Resistant Tuberculosis (MDR-TB) Cases Among Notified Pulmonary Tuberculosis Cases at 12,000 Cases. Pakistan is overtaken by Ukraine, which was ranked number 4 at 13,000 Cases and is followed by Philippines at 11,000 Cases.
